Well you can’t be an “overlander” without a bunch of oversized condiment containers.
Mayo ketchup or mustard, got all the flavors covered.
Mounted this swing out the same way as the tire swing out, old farm tractor pins and eyes welded on a box to hold the fuel
word of advice, you don’t need 15 gallons back there. after many years of lugging around an extra 10 gallons of fuel and 5 gallons of water I realized I’ve never actually used more than one gas tank or one water jug
15 gallons is cool, but the next rig setup will only get 10 gallons.
Plus three jugs won’t fit with a 35 on the back of the rig, the 33 clears no problem but I’m not on the 33 train anymore
